| """ |
| Constants used in various CI tests |
| """ |
| import subprocess |
| import pathlib |
| from typing import List, Any |
| |
| REPO_ROOT = pathlib.Path(__file__).resolve().parent.parent.parent.parent |
| GITHUB_SCRIPT_ROOT = REPO_ROOT / "ci" / "scripts" / "github" |
| JENKINS_SCRIPT_ROOT = REPO_ROOT / "ci" / "scripts" / "jenkins" |
| |
| |
| class TempGit: |
| """ |
| A wrapper to run commands in a directory (specifically for use in CI tests) |
| """ |
| |
| def __init__(self, cwd): |
| self.cwd = cwd |
| # Jenkins git is too old and doesn't have 'git init --initial-branch', |
| # so init and checkout need to be separate steps |
| self.run("init", stderr=subprocess.PIPE, stdout=subprocess.PIPE) |
| self.run("checkout", "-b", "main", stderr=subprocess.PIPE) |
| self.run("remote", "add", "origin", "https://github.com/apache/tvm.git") |
| |
| def run(self, *args, **kwargs): |
| """ |
| Run a git command based on *args |
| """ |
| proc = subprocess.run( |
| ["git"] + list(args), encoding="utf-8", cwd=self.cwd, check=False, **kwargs |
| ) |
| if proc.returncode != 0: |
| raise RuntimeError(f"git command failed: '{args}'") |
| |
| return proc |
| |
| |
| def run_script(command: List[Any], check: bool = True, **kwargs): |
| """ |
| Wrapper to run a script and print its output if there was an error |
| """ |
| command = [str(c) for c in command] |
| kwargs_to_send = { |
| "stdout": subprocess.PIPE, |
| "stderr": subprocess.PIPE, |
| "encoding": "utf-8", |
| } |
| kwargs_to_send.update(kwargs) |
| proc = subprocess.run( |
| command, |
| check=False, |
| **kwargs_to_send, |
| ) |
| if check and proc.returncode != 0: |
| raise RuntimeError(f"Process failed:\nstdout:\n{proc.stdout}\n\nstderr:\n{proc.stderr}") |
| |
| return proc |
